Verdict

The Gigabyte Aorus GeForce RTX 5070 Master is a high-end graphics card built on NVIDIA's Blackwell architecture, featuring 6,144 CUDA cores and 12GB of cutting-edge GDDR7 memory on a 192-bit interface. It distinguishes itself with an aggressive factory overclock to 2715 MHz and the robust Windforce cooling system, which utilizes a large vapor chamber and three 'Hawk' fans for superior thermal management. Key pros include its elite performance for 1440p gaming, DLSS 4 support, and premium enthusiast features like a customizable side LCD Edge View screen and vibrant RGB Halo lighting. However, the card's massive 3.25-slot thickness and 317mm length may require a spacious chassis, and its premium price point sits significantly higher than standard 5070 models.

What customers like about GIGABYTE AORUS GeForce RTX 5070 Master?

  • Elite thermal management using the Windforce triple-fan system and vapor chamber, resulting in very cool operating temperatures
  • Premium aesthetics featuring a customizable LCD Edge View screen for GIFs/stats and 'RGB Halo' lighting
  • Exceptionally quiet operation, even under heavy gaming loads, with a dedicated 'Silent' BIOS mode available
  • Significant performance leap for users upgrading from older hardware like the RTX 3070 or 20 series
  • Support for DLSS 4 and Multi-Frame Generation, which provides massive frame rate boosts in compatible titles
  • High build quality with a reinforced metal backplate and a specialized coating to resist dust and corrosion

What customers dislike about GIGABYTE AORUS GeForce RTX 5070 Master?

  • Large physical dimensions (approx. 360mm length and 4-slot thickness) may require case modifications or high-volume chassis
  • Minimal raw 'rasterization' performance gains over the previous-gen RTX 4070 Super unless AI features like DLSS 4 are used
  • Higher price point compared to other RTX 5070 models, making the premium features difficult for some to justify
  • Limited VRAM (12GB) is seen by some as a bottleneck for long-term 4K gaming or future-proofing
  • Potential for software conflicts with RGB/LCD management through the Gigabyte Control Center
  • The included anti-sag bracket can conflict with front-mounted case fans in some popular mid-tower cases
